Status Update for Comprehensive Traffic Study in Mimico

The decision

2020-02-05 · Etobicoke York Community Council · adopted

As filed

Etobicoke York Community Council: 1. Requested the General Manager, Transportation Services to provide an update on the status of Item EY32.85 - Request for Comprehensive Traffic Study in Mimico, including work completed to date, parties responsible, immediate next steps, estimated completion date, and opportunities to accelerate completion, to the March 12, 2020 meeting of Etobicoke York Community Council.

In July 2018, I requested a comprehensive traffic study for the Mimico neighbourhood of the former Ward 6, roughly bounded by Royal York Road to the west, Cavell Avenue to the north, Louise Street to the east, and Lake Shore Blvd West to the south, to assess the appropriateness and feasibility of further speed limit reductions, turning restrictions, vertical deflection traffic calming measures (e.g. speed humps, raised intersections, raised pedestrian crossings), Horizontal deflection traffic calming measures (e.g.

chicanes, curb extensions, mid-block pinch-points, traffic islands, traffic circles, raised median islands, curb radius reductions, directional closures to narrow existing one way streets), improved pedestrian crossings and navigation throughout affected area (in conjunction with or complementary to traffic calming measures), and any other measures that may be appropriate in addressing traffic speed, volume, and pedestrian safety. To date I have been provided several different and contradictory updates on the status of this item, as well as who is responsible for completing the study. The motion seeks an update of the status of this item be brought to the next Etobicoke York Community Council meeting, on March 12, 2020.
